Al Furjan is a newer master-planned community developed by Nakheel, made up mainly of villas and townhouses close to Ibn Battuta Mall and Discovery Gardens, and it is primarily a residential area rather than a commercial one. Standalone office towers or dedicated business districts do not exist within Al Furjan itself, so office renovation demand here is limited and needs to be framed honestly around what actually exists, small retail-adjacent office units within the community retail clusters and neighbourhood centres built alongside the residential blocks, used mainly by real estate brokerages, small trading businesses and service providers that benefit from being close to where residents already shop and pass through daily. This is a modest, community-scale scope rather than a corporate office market, and we approach every Al Furjan project with that in mind.

Quick Answer: Office renovation in Al Furjan generally means fitting out a small office unit within one of the community retail clusters or neighbourhood centres, since this Nakheel villa and townhouse community has no standalone commercial office stock of its own. A typical fit-out covers 200 to 800 square feet and runs AED 40,000 to 120,000 depending on partition and finish scope, generally taking 3 to 5 weeks. Community retail cluster management approval is required alongside standard DEWA and Municipality requirements before work begins.

Understanding Office Renovation

Office renovation covers partitioning, false ceilings, lighting, power and data cabling, flooring and a small reception or waiting area where the unit allows for one, all aimed at turning a shell or dated unit into a functional, professional space. In Al Furjan, this work applies almost exclusively to the small commercial units built into the community retail clusters and neighbourhood centres that sit alongside the villa and townhouse blocks, spaces originally intended for retail or service use that are also leased by brokerages, trading offices and similar small businesses. Because these units are generally compact, a fit-out here is about making efficient, well-organised use of a modest footprint rather than large-scale open-plan office design.

Given that these units were built as part of a retail-oriented development rather than a dedicated office park, the existing shell condition varies from unit to unit depending on age and previous tenancy, and we always start with an assessment of what electrical capacity, plumbing and structural condition already exist before finalising a design. A unit that previously operated as a retail shop, for instance, may need additional office-specific cabling and a reworked layout to suit desk-based work rather than a shop counter arrangement, while a unit fitted out previously as an office may only need a finishes refresh.

Frontage design also matters more in an Al Furjan retail cluster unit than it would in an office tower, since these units typically face a shared pedestrian walkway or parking court rather than a private lobby, and the shopfront glazing, signage panel and entrance door are effectively part of how the business presents itself to passing residents. We factor this into the layout from the start, positioning reception desks and any client-facing seating close enough to the frontage to feel welcoming without leaving sensitive paperwork or screens visible to anyone walking past outside. Parking availability at most Al Furjan retail clusters is shared rather than dedicated to any one unit, so we also confirm with retail cluster management what, if any, dedicated client parking or loading arrangement applies before finalising a design that assumes a particular level of drop-off convenience.

Al Furjan — A Residential Community With Retail-Adjacent Offices

Al Furjan was developed by Nakheel as a villa and townhouse community close to Ibn Battuta Mall and Discovery Gardens, and its layout reflects that residential focus, with several neighbourhood retail clusters and pavilion-style centres built to serve residents rather than any standalone commercial or business district. Because of this, there is no meaningful stock of dedicated office buildings within Al Furjan itself, and businesses looking for office space here are, in practice, looking at the same small commercial units that also house cafes, salons, pharmacies and convenience retail across these community clusters.

The businesses that do operate offices from these units in Al Furjan are typically real estate brokerages serving the surrounding villa and townhouse sales and rental market, small trading or service companies that benefit from being visible to residents passing through the retail cluster, and occasionally a professional services office such as an accountant or consultant serving the local community directly. Given the residential character of the wider area, these office units tend to prioritise a welcoming, approachable appearance suited to residents walking in off the street rather than the more formal corporate look expected in a business-district tower elsewhere in Dubai, and we scope designs accordingly.

Because Al Furjan is still a relatively young community compared with many of the longer-established districts covered by this service, the pattern of commercial demand here continues to shift as more phases of the development are handed over and occupied. Retail clusters that were quiet a few years ago have in some cases filled up with a wider mix of tenants as surrounding villa and townhouse phases reached full occupancy, and we have seen a corresponding gradual increase in businesses wanting a proper office fit-out rather than operating out of a bare shell. This growth trajectory is worth factoring into a renovation decision, since a unit fitted out well now is likely to sit within an increasingly established retail cluster rather than a still-developing one.

Approvals — Retail Cluster Management, DEWA and Municipality

Because Al Furjan commercial units sit within community retail clusters that are typically managed by a dedicated retail or community management team rather than an individual landlord acting alone, fit-out work generally needs to be submitted to that management team for approval before construction begins, covering matters such as shopfront signage, permitted working hours and any changes visible from the shared walkway. Electrical work needs to align with DEWA requirements where new circuits or additional load are introduced, and structural or partition changes are reported to Dubai Municipality where the scope requires it. We confirm the specific retail cluster approval process for your unit at the start of the project, since requirements can differ slightly between the various Al Furjan neighbourhood centres, and handle the submission and coordination as part of the project scope.

Cost Factors for Al Furjan Office Renovation

  • Previous unit use — converting a former retail unit to office use generally costs more than refreshing an existing office fit-out
  • Unit size — most Al Furjan retail cluster units are compact, which keeps overall project cost proportional
  • Retail cluster approval requirements — signage and shopfront-related conditions can add modest cost and coordination time
  • Finish specification — a welcoming, resident-facing finish level versus a purely functional back-office specification shifts the total noticeably

As a general guide, an office fit-out in an Al Furjan retail cluster unit runs from roughly AED 40,000 to 120,000 depending on unit size, previous use and finish specification.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Starting work without retail cluster management approval — this can lead to a stop-work request partway through the project
  • Assuming a former retail or food unit has adequate office cabling already — this is rarely the case and needs proper assessment
  • Overspecifying finishes beyond what a community-facing unit needs — this adds cost without adding practical value in this setting
  • Skipping a written itemised quote — a lump sum figure makes it difficult to track scope changes once work begins
